Ver Mensaje Individual
  #3 (permalink)  
Antiguo 13/09/2004, 06:23
Avatar de TCL_ZIP
TCL_ZIP
 
Fecha de Ingreso: noviembre-2003
Ubicación: Esporles, Mallorca, España
Mensajes: 690
Antigüedad: 20 años, 5 meses
Puntos: 4
He puesto ese código pero solo me lo hace en el primer listbox, me explico:
Tengo un formulario con un par de listbox y a la izquierda una casilla donde escriben el numero de entradas que quieren de cada tipo. Y por eso uso varios listbox con el mismo contenido, pero apesar de poner el mismo còdigo, solo me muestra el primero, eso porque puede ser?
el còdigo es el siguiente:
Código PHP:
mysql_select_db($database_teatredelmar$teatredelmar);
$sql="SELECT * FROM preus WHERE categories like '$tipus'"
$preus=mysql_query($sql) or die(mysql_error()); 
y la tabla con los datos, el siguiente:
Código HTML:
<table width="487" border="1" cellpadding="0" cellspacing="1">
          <tr bgcolor="#318495">
            <td width="127"><div align="center" class="Estilo2">No. de butaques que vol comprar </div></td>
            <td width="115"><div align="center" class="Estilo2">Preus</div></td>
            <td width="115"><div align="center" class="Estilo2">
            Nom i llinatges:</div></td>
            <td width="115"><div align="center"><span class="Estilo2">DNI:</span></div></td>
      </tr>
          <tr bgcolor="#B0B0B0">
            <td><div align="center">
                <input name="numero" type="text" id="numero" value="1" size="2" maxlength="2">
            </div></td>
            <td><div align="center">
				<select name="desc_preu" id="desc_preu">
			   <? while ($row=mysql_fetch_array($preus)){ 
   echo "<option value=\"".$row['ID']."\">".$row['tipus']." ".$row['preu']."&euro;</option>\n"; 
}
				?>
               </select>
            </div></td>
            <td><input name="requiredNom" type="text" id="Nom" size="30"></td>
            <td><input name="requiredDNI" type="text" id="DNI" size="15"></td>
          </tr>
		  <? if ($row_actuacio['tipus'] == Normal) { ?>
          <tr bgcolor="#B0B0B0">
            <td><div align="center">
                <input name="numero_2" type="text" id="numero_2" value="0" size="2" maxlength="2">
            </div></td>
            <td><div align="center">
              <select name="desc_preu_2" id="desc_preu_2">
                   <? while ($row=mysql_fetch_array($preus)){ 
   echo "<option value=\"".$row['ID']."\">".$row['tipus']." ".$row['preu']."&euro;</option>\n"; 
}
				?>
              </select>
            </div></td>
            <td colspan="2" rowspan="3">&nbsp;</td>
          </tr>
          <tr bgcolor="#B0B0B0">
            <td><div align="center">
                <input name="numero_3" type="text" id="numero_3" value="0" size="2" maxlength="2">
            </div></td>
            <td><div align="center">
              <select name="desc_preu_3" id="desc_preu_3">
                  <? while ($row=mysql_fetch_array($preus)){ 
   echo "<option value=\"".$row['ID']."\">".$row['tipus']." ".$row['preu']."&euro;</option>\n"; 
}
				?>
              </select>
            </div></td>
          </tr>
          <tr bgcolor="#B0B0B0">
            <td><div align="center">
                <input name="numero_4" type="text" id="numero_4" value="0" size="2" maxlength="2">
            </div></td>
            <td><div align="center">
              <select name="desc_preu_4" id="desc_preu_4">
                  <? while ($row=mysql_fetch_array($preus)){ 
   echo "<option value=\"".$row['ID']."\">".$row['tipus']." ".$row['preu']."&euro;</option>\n"; 
}
				?>
              </select>
            </div></td>
          </tr><? } ?>
          <tr>
            <td colspan="4"><div align="center">
              <input type="submit" name="Submit" value="Enviar">
            </div></td>
          </tr>
        </table>